**Q: A customer's crash report never appears in Splintr — what now?**

A: Check the Hollowpine ingest dashboard first. If the pipeline is paused, crash bundles queue on-device for up to 72 hours; no data is lost. Escalate only if the queue exceeds 10k. To restart ingest you'll need the recovery console, which accepts the passphrase below.

vault phrase of yawig-bawig = fenael-norael-eliox-gilox-casath-druath-zorys-istwyn-jorwyn

## Who to contact: string extraction

The `polyglot-extract` script pulls translatable strings from plugin manifests during the Wrenvale build. Plugin authors should not modify the script; instead, follow the annotation format in the localization guide. For extraction failures, unexpected omissions, or format questions, reach the localization tooling team at the address below.

escalation mailbox, bafog-fafog: ulador@paliqlabs.internal

Minutes — Management Meeting, Harlow Point office

Present: Vessa Trun, Oke Maddern, Pell Currow. Main item: sale of the Quillfarm packaging unit. Two bidders still in play; Oke thinks one will blink first. Diligence room opens Monday. Staff comms drafted but held. Board vote targeted for month-end. Context on our wider intentions follows.

management briefing: Project Ulavan slips by two quarters because of the staffing delay.

### Changelog — Shorewind Tide Widget v2.3

Heads up for new folks: we changed the widget defaults. It now shows two tide cycles instead of four, uses the station nearest the viewer, and refreshes every 15 minutes rather than hourly. Old embeds keep their saved settings. Fresh installs of the widget now start with these values:

deployment values, kajep-kageg:
[praix]
host = praix.paliqcorp.corp
user = praix_svc
database = praix_prod